🔍 Unraveling the Importance of Transaction Fees

Transaction fees are an integral part of any blockchain network, serving several key purposes:

  • Security and Functionality: Fees incentivize network participants (miners or validators) to process and verify transactions, ensuring the network remains secure and operational.
  • Efficient Resource Allocation: By prioritizing transactions based on the fees attached, the network can allocate resources effectively and prevent congestion or spam.
  • Long-Term Sustainability: As block rewards diminish over time, transaction fees become an increasingly vital revenue stream for network participants, contributing to the network's longevity.

🧮 Factors Influencing Transaction Fees

Several factors come into play when determining transaction fees:

  • Transaction Size: Larger transactions consume more resources, resulting in higher fees.
  • Network Congestion: During periods of high network activity, fees can increase as users compete for limited resources.
  • Urgency: Users can opt to pay higher fees to prioritize their transactions and ensure faster processing.

🎯 Optimizing Transaction Fees in Your Blockchain Applications

To effectively manage transaction fees in your blockchain projects, consider the following strategies:

  • Batching Transactions: Grouping multiple transactions into a single batch can minimize fees by reducing the number of individual transactions.
  • Timing Transactions: Sending transactions during off-peak hours can help avoid network congestion and potentially lower fees.
  • Leveraging Fee Estimation Tools: Utilize fee estimation tools to determine the optimal fee based on current network conditions.
